Jhon Duran door open for West Ham
The South American starlet’s future surely lies away from Villa Park.
I just don’t envisage a scenario where a player can push that hard to leave, disrespect his club that much (doing the crossed Hammers sign during a live stream) and not be sold.

Now there could be a real chance that the Hammers could sign him on deadline day in my opinion, because of a plan Villa apparently have up their sleeve.
According to a report from Caught Offside, Villa are debating whether or not to make a move to sign Everton striker Dominic Calvert-Lewin before tonight’s 11pm deadline.
Calvert-Lewin has bagged 68 goals in 249 games for Everton – 54 of which have come in the Premier League.
If Unai Emery does bring the 27-year-old to Villa Park, I think that will be a clear indication that he’s willing to let Duran leave the club.
And West Ham should be monitoring this situation very closely indeed throughout the day.
